In session

Das Sexy Clap have been stalwarts of the Worcester music scene for a number of years and combine members of bands such as Cape Of Good Hope, And What Will Be Left Of Them? and Hey You Guys!
 
Now, at the start of the year, Huw Stephens launched his own section of the BBC Playlister website, showcasing ones to watch out for in 2015.
 
A quarter of those initial 12 acts were from Worcestershire - including this band.
 
But we knew that anyway, having featured in Andy O'Hare's Top Ten tunes for two years running!
 
Previously a drum/guitar/vocal duo, the addition of a bass guitar has taken their signature sound into unheralded territory with catch hooks shrouded in a cloak of distortion.

WW2 Cello

What's the oldest thing that you've got lying around, that doesn't get used?
 
A family heir loom or maybe just an old pair of socks?
 
Well, at the Worcester Museum and Art Gallery there is a cello that was cobbled together in the trenches during World War One.
 
That's not especially old for something sitting in a museum, but the instrument has remained silent for almost 100 years.
 
That was until this week...

Frank Freeman's

Tonight, a reunion's being held to celebrate the legendary Kidderminster music venue Frank Freeman's.
 
John Peel, Led Zeppelin and Fleetwood Mac were regulars at the club back in its heyday, but the site of the former club is to be demolished soon.
 
But it will never be forgotten.
 
A documentary's being made about what the club means to people, there are also plans for a heritage trail around Kidderminster, taking in the club and even the possibility of a statue of Frank.

BBC Introducing in Worcester
This month’s sessions were recorded at The Marr’s Bar in Worcester.
 
The venue has been running for longer than we’ve been on-the-air and has seen some of the region’s best talent perform there.
 
Every week, we meet loads of musicians who are struggling to get gigs outside of their home town, so these last few months we’ve been bringing more bands over Fromes Hill to perform in their neighbouring county than ever before.
